1997 - Did not play.
1998 - Did not play.
1999 - Won three singles titles and eight doubles titles on ITF Circuit.
2000 - Played first three WTA main draws, reaching 2r once but falling 1r twice (incl. Olympics); fell in qualifying twice (incl. US Open); won one WTA doubles title; won eight singles titles and six doubles titles on ITF Circuit.
2001 - Fell 1r once and in qualifying twice (Australian Open, Wimbledon); won two singles titles and one doubles title on ITF Circuit.
2002 - Won one singles title on ITF Circuit.
2003 - Did not play.
2004 - First Top 100 season; won first WTA title at Guangzhou (d. Sucha in final; was first Chinese to win a WTA title); reached 2r once (Beijing - l. to Kuznetsova 63 67(6) 76(3); held 2mp third set); made Top 100 debut on October 2 (rose from No.145 to No.92); won five singles and one doubles title on ITF Circuit.
2005 - Another Top 100 season; runner-up at Estoril (l. to Safarova in final); SF three times at Hobart (l. to Zheng), Rabat (ret. vs. Zheng w/right ankle sprain) and Bali (l. to Davenport); QF twice at Hyderabad and Guangzhou; reached 3r twice (incl. Australian Open) and 2r twice; fell 1r four times (incl. US Open); made Top 50 debut on February 14 (rose from No.57 to No.50); missed Wimbledon for in Chinese national championships.
2006 - First Top 30 season; runner-up at Estoril (ret. vs. Zheng w/heat illness in first all-Chinese WTA final); SF at Berlin (l. to Petrova); QF six times at Doha, Strasbourg, Wimbledon (first Chinese to reach a Grand Slam QF; l. to Clijsters), Stockholm, Beijing and Guangzhou; reached 4r twice (incl. US Open), 3r twice (incl. Roland Garros) and 2r four times; fell 1r six times (incl. Australian Open); had two ranking breakthroughs for China, becoming first Chinese to crack Top 30 (after Birmingham on June 19; rose from No.32 to No.30) and first Chinese to crack Top 20 (after Stockholm on August 14; rose from No.22 to No.20); won one WTA doubles title.
2007 - Another Top 30 season; SF twice at Sydney (l. to Clijsters) and Indian Wells (l. to Hantuchova); QF three times at Miami, Strasbourg and Birmingham; reached 4r once (Australian Open), 3r twice (incl. Roland Garros) and 2r four times; fell 1r once; withdrew from all events after Birmingham w/right rib stress fracture (incl. Wimbledon, US Open).
2008 - Another Top 30 season; won second WTA title at Gold Coast in first week back from six-month injury lay-off (d. Azarenka in final); SF four times at Antwerp (l. to Knapp), Doha (l. to Zvonareva), Olympics (l. to Safina; l. to Zvonareva in bronze medal match) and Luxembourg (l. to Wozniacki); QF at Stuttgart; reached 4r once (US Open), 3r once (Australian Open) and 2r twice (incl. Wimbledon); fell 1r four times; withdrew from 10 events w/right knee injury (incl. Roland Garros); had surgery on March 31 and returned to action in June.
2009 - First Top 20 season; runner-up twice at Monterrey (l. to Bartoli in final) and Birmingham (l. to Rybarikova in final); SF at Tokyo [Pan Pacific] (l. to Jankovic); QF twice at Miami and US Open (l. to Clijsters); reached 4r twice (incl. Roland Garros), 3r three times (incl. Wimbledon) and 2r four times; fell 1r three times; withdrew from six tournaments during season w/right knee injury (incl. Australian Open).
2010 - Near-Top 10 season (finishing No.11); won third WTA title at Birmingham (d. Sharapova in final); SF four times at Australian Open (first Grand Slam SF; l. to S.Williams), Warsaw (l. to Dulgheru), Copenhagen (l. to Zakopalova) and Beijing (l. to Zvonareva); QF five times at Dubai, Stuttgart, Madrid, Wimbledon (l. to S.Williams) and Bali; reached 3r three times (incl. Roland Garros) and 2r three times (incl. Indian Wells - l. to Baltacha 76(6) 26 76(7); held 3mp in third set tie-break); fell 1r five times (incl. US Open); made Top 10 debut on February 1 (after Australian Open; rose from No.17 to No.10; first Chinese in Top 10).
2011 - First Top 5 season (finishing No.5), highlighed by two phenomenal stretches around first two Grand Slams; went 11-1 in Australia, winning fourth WTA title at Sydney (d. Clijsters in final; first Chinese to win a Premier title) and reaching first Grand Slam final at Australian Open (l. to Clijsters in final; first Asian, male or female, to reach a Grand Slam final); went 13-2 in last three events of clay court season, reaching SFs at Madrid (l. to Kvitova) and Rome (l. to Stosur) then winning first Grand Slam title at Roland Garros (d. Schiavone in final; was first Asian, male or female, to win a Grand Slam title); equalled Asian ranking record afterwards on June 6 (rose from No.7 to No.4, tying Japan's Date-Krumm for highest-ranked Asian ever); went 1-5 between February and May, losing opening matches at Dubai (l. to Wickmayer 67(6) 76(6) 62; held 4mp at 6-2 in second set tie-break), Doha, Indian Wells and Miami (l. to Larsson 75 67(5) 76(5); held 3mp at 5-4 third set) and second match at Stuttgart; went 6-9 after Roland Garros, reaching one SF at New Haven (l. to Cetkovska 62 57 76(9); held mp at 8-7 in third set tie-break) but losing early at all seven other events, incl. Wimbledon (l. to Lisicki 36 64 86 in 2r; held 2mp at 5-3 third set), US Open (l. to Halep in 1r) and in RR stage at first WTA Championships (went 1-2 in RR, d. Sharapova but losing to Azarenka and Stosur).
2012 - Second straight Top 10 season (finishing No.7); won sixth WTA title at Cincinnati (d. Kerber in final); runner-up three times at Sydney (l. to Azarenka), Rome (l. to Sharapova 46 64 76(5) in final; held mp at 6-5 third set) and Montréal (l. to Kvitova in final); SF at Beijing (l. to Sharapova); QF four times at Indian Wells, Miami, Stuttgart and Madrid; reached 4r twice (Australian Open - l. to Clijsters 46 76(4) 64; held 4mp at 6-2 in second set tie-break, and Roland Garros), 3r twice (incl. US Open) and 2r once (Wimbledon); fell 1r twice (incl. Olympics); fell in RR stage at WTA Championships (went 1-2 in RR); struggled w/low back injury in February (retired in Paris [Indoors] 2r then withdrew from Dubai).
Winner (7): 2013 - Shenzhen; 2012 - Cincinnati; 2011 - Sydney, Roland Garros; 2010 - Birmingham; 2008 - Gold Coast; 2004 - Guangzhou.
Finalist (10): 2013 - Australian Open, Stuttgart; 2012 - Sydney, Rome, Montréal; 2011 - Australian Open; 2009 - Monterrey, Birmingham; 2006 - Estoril; 2005 - Estoril.
DOUBLES
Winner (2): 2006 - Birmingham (w/Jankovic); 2000 - Tashkent (w/T.Li).
ADDITIONAL
Chinese Fed Cup Team, 1999-2002, 2005-06, 2008; Chinese Olympic Team, 2000, 2008, 2012.
